Titre de hF837h70872.txt

# Réponse finale obtenue du bot:
response = « Voici un exemple de code Python qui crée un tableau Excel à l’aide de la bibliothèque `openpyxl` pour des utilisations commerciales :
« `python
# Importation des bibliothèques nécessaires
import openpyxl
from openpyxl import Workbook, load_workbook

# Création d’un nouveau livre Excel
wb = Workbook()

# Sélection de la feuille active (défaut : « Sheet »)
ws = wb.active
ws.title = « Tableau Commercial »

# En-tête du tableau
ws[‘A1’] = ‘Nom de l\’entreprise’
ws[‘B1’] = ‘Adresse’
ws[‘C1’] = ‘Ville’
ws[‘D1’] = ‘Code postal’

# Fonction pour ajouter une nouvelle ligne au tableau
def ajout_ligne(nom, adresse, ville, code_postal):
# Vérification que les champs ne sont pas vides
if nom and adresse and ville and code_postal:
ws.append([nom, adresse, ville, code_postal])
print(f »Ligne ajoutée pour {nom} »)
else:
print(« Veuillez remplir tous les champs »)

# Fonction pour supprimer une ligne au tableau
def suppression_ligne(num_ligne):
# Vérification que la ligne existe bien
if num_ligne <= len(ws.values): ws.delete_rows(num_ligne) print(f"Ligne {num_ligne} supprimée") else: print("Ligne inexistante") # Fonction pour modifier une ligne au tableau def modification_ligne(num_ligne, nom, adresse, ville, code_postal): # Vérification que la ligne existe bien if num_ligne <= len(ws.values): ws.cell(row=num_ligne+1, column=1).value = nom ws.cell(row=num_ligne+1, column=2).value = adresse ws.cell(row=num_ligne+1, column=3).value = ville ws.cell(row=num_ligne+1, column=4).value = code_postal print(f"Ligne {num_ligne} modifiée") else: print("Ligne inexistante") # Fonction pour enregistrer le fichier Excel def enregistrement_fichier(): wb.save("Tableau_Commercial.xlsx") print("Fichier enregistré avec succès") # Exemple d'utilisation des fonctions ajout_ligne("Entreprise 1", "Adresse 1", "Ville 1", "12345") suppression_ligne(2) modification_ligne(3, "Nouvelle entreprise", "Nouvelle adresse", "Nouvelle ville", "67890") # Enregistrement du fichier Excel enregistrement_fichier() ``` Ce code crée un tableau Excel avec les colonnes suivantes : * Nom de l'entreprise * Adresse * Ville * Code postal Il définit également plusieurs fonctions pour ajouter, supprimer et modifier des lignes dans le tableau. Finalement, il enregistre le fichier Excel sous le nom "Tableau_Commercial.xlsx". Notez que vous devrez installer la bibliothèque `openpyxl` si elle n'est pas déjà installée. Vous pouvez le faire en exécutant la commande suivante dans votre terminal : ```bash pip install openpyxl ``` J'espère que cela vous aidera !"

Retour en haut